Skip to main content

Revision #268078

AuthorMoira Quirk
(bb3f4118-4663-42f7-bbf1-328c69c097a8)

Disambiguation
British actress

Created by jwillikers, 2026-01-01 17:44:45

Revision Notes

No revision notes present